Following the release of the draft 2025 Victorian Transmission Plan (https://www.energy.vic.gov.au/renewable-energy/vicgrid/the-victorian-transmission-plan), VicGrid is now calling for submissions (closing date 5 November 2025) to provide feedback on its Draft Community Engagement and Social Value Guidelines for Renewable Energy and Transmission Projects. This is part of a broader consultation process for community and industry into VicGrid’s Victorian Access Regime (see more information and consultation documents here - 


SRRCG has made a submission to VicGrid on these Community Engagement and Social Value Guidelines which you can read here:


Developers wishing to develop renewable energy projects outside a REZ (eg in the Strathbogies/Yea districts) will have to apply to VicGrid for access to connect to the transmission infrastructure (the grid) under the new Victorian Access Regime. Conditions for granting grid access include demonstrating that 1) the project will not curtail current or future projects within REZs accessing transmission infrastructure; AND 2) that the developer meets government expectations including community and Traditional Owners engagement and provides meaningful social value and economic benefits. The second criteria is the subject of SRRCG's submission.

Strathbogies Responsible Renewable Community Group

The Strathbogies Responsible Renewables Community Group is focussed on a fact based, respectful and inclusive process regarding Fera Australia's windfarm and powerline proposal for the Southern Strathbogie Ranges. The Strathbogies Responsible Renewables Community Group (SRRCG) is a registered legal entity which has been formed at the behest of the local community to campaign to convince decision makers not to approve the Project.
